SUMMARY:Feast of Qudrat / Power (Baha'i)
DESCRIPTION:Wherever they live\, Baha’is gather every 19 days for what we call a Feast. This is a members-only event comprising three parts: \n1. A spiritual portion that’s the time for prayer and reflection; \n2. A business portion for consultation about administrative issues (plans for forming classes\, organizing to perform community service\, observing holy days\, or any ideas or projects community members wish to discuss. It’s also a time when local members can ask their Local Assembly to forward their concerns to the National Assembly; \n3. A social portion that can consist of anything from just glasses of water to a full-course dinner.

SUMMARY:Day of the Covenant (Bahá’í)
DESCRIPTION:The festival commemorates Bahá’u’lláh’s appointment of His eldest son\, ‘Abdu’l-Bahá\, as the Center of His Covenant. \nWork is not prohibited\, children may attend school. \nMore Information

SUMMARY:Ascension of ‘Abdu’l‑Bahá
DESCRIPTION:Today Baha’is celebrate the life of  ‘Abdu’l-Bahá\, the eldest Son of Bahá’u’lláh\, known to Bahá’ís as the Perfect Exemplar and the Mystery of God\, a living embodiment of Bahá’u’lláh’s teachings. He passed away on this date in 1921. \nYou can learn more here.
